Raspberry-Pecan Cheesecake Bars

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 325°F (163°C). Grease a 9x13 inch baking dish.
  2. In a medium bowl, combine the graham cracker crumbs and melted butter. Press the mixture into the bottom of the prepared baking dish.
  3. In a large bowl, beat the cream cheese, sugar, and vanilla extract until smooth. Add the eggs, one at a time, beating well after each addition. Gradually add the flour and mix until just combined.
  4. Spread the cream cheese mixture evenly over the crust. Drop spoonfuls of raspberry preserves onto the cream cheese mixture. Use a knife to swirl the preserves into the cream cheese mixture. Sprinkle the chopped pecans on top.
  5. Bake for 35-40 minutes, or until the edges are set and the center is slightly jiggly. Remove from the oven and let cool in the pan on a wire rack for 2 hours.
  6. Refrigerate for at least 2 hours, or until chilled and set. Cut into bars and serve.
